Cleaningmetalgreaselters
The metal grease lters can be cleaned in hot detergent
solution or washed in the dishwasher. They should be
cleaned every 2 months use, or more frequently if use is
particularly heavy.
• Open the visor by pulling it.
• Remove the lter, pushing the lever towards the back
of the unit and at the same time pulling downward.
• Wash the lter without bending it, leave it to dry thoroughly
before replacing (if the surface of the lter changes
color over time, this will have absolutely no effect on
its efciency).
• Replace, taking care to ensure that the handle faces
forward.
• Cleaning in dishwasher may dull the nish of the metal
grease lter.
• Close the visor.
Replacing Activated Charcoal Filter
The Activated Charcoal Filters are not washable
and cannot be regenerated, and must be replaced
approximately every 4 months of operation, or more
frequently with heavy usage.
• Open the visor by pulling it.
• Remove the Filter, pushing it towards the back of the
unit and at the same time pulling downward.
• Remove the saturated Activated Charcoal Filters, as
indicated (A).
• Fit the new Filters, as indicated (B).
• Replace, taking care to ensure that the handle faces
forwards.
• Close the visor.

Lighting unit
• Turn off electrical supply before replacing
bulbs, and make sure bulbs are cool to
touch before proceeding.
• Remove the snap-on lamp cover by
levering it from under the metal ring,
supporting it with one hand.
• Replace the lamp with a new one of the
same type, making sure that you insert
the two pins properly into the housings
on the lamp holder.
• Replace the snap-on lamp cover.
